Ticket: Cleaning-crew access, Bramhall Wing

Hey night team — the Tidemark cleaning crew starts tonight and they'll be covering floors 4 through 6 of the Bramhall Wing. They've got their own cart lift fob, but the stairwell doors auto-lock after 21:00, so someone keeps getting stranded on 5. Please prop nothing open (fire marshal's orders) — instead, give the crew lead the after-hours stairwell code when they sign in. That code is listed just below.

staff pass of kawip-hawef = bdg-QLP-2

Handover — Level 5 opening. The new floor at Drayton Point opens Monday for the Larkfield team. Desks are unassigned for the first fortnight; kitchens are stocked Tuesday. New starters should collect badges from me at the Level 1 desk first. Until badges are programmed, use the temporary door code below.

staff pass of haduf-yagaf = bdg-DBSQF-1

Q3 Planning Note — Inventory Write-Down

We will record a write-down on Torvex handset stock held at the Ellsmere warehouse, reflecting slower-than-forecast sell-through of the older models. Sales leads should prioritise clearing remaining units through bundle offers before the new line lands in October. No impact on commission structures this quarter. Finance will circulate revised targets next week. The relevant business plan note appears below.

board note of kajeg-taduf: The pricing group signed off on a budget of $23.8 million for Project Istys. The renewal with Norwynix Group closes at $56.9 million a year, 52 percent above the last contract.

**14:22** — Heads up, plugin authors: the Pointwheel loyalty ledger double-credited redemptions for about nine minutes after the Marbleton cache flush. Plugins reading raw balances saw inflated totals; the reconciler has since squared everything. If your plugin caches balances, invalidate anything from this window. The offending deploy is identified by the trace token below.

session token of bahip-hawep = htk4_b0c1